Transaction 10518c36786e4a189eda75f42e537f032a49cbec62339afba8199575f35e88e8

1 Input
2 Outputs
  • 10518c36786e4a189eda75f42e537f032a49cbec62339afba8199575f35e88e8:0
  • value  2882340
    address  3FnHRu6epx9sSiZwuq3fCtEz5NwjDM678V
  • 10518c36786e4a189eda75f42e537f032a49cbec62339afba8199575f35e88e8:1
  • value  700000
    address  19GeeapnE7EsG4EKbRq5vCQDu4mH4Uatrz